These Strawberry Dumplings served with a scoop of vanilla ice cream are perfect for spring and summer. Crescent rolls filled with strawberries and baked in butter & brown sugar sauce. They’re the perfect balance between soft and crispy!

Crescent rolls are baked in a sauce made with a lot of butter and brown sugar spiced up with vanilla and cinnamon, they really get an interesting and tasty texture. The downside of the roll stays soft and juicy and the top becomes crispy and irresistible.

Strawberry Dumplings

5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star 4.7 from 6 reviews

  • Author: OMGChocolateDesserts.com
  • Strawberry Dumplings (7)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Strawberry Dumplings (8)Cook Time: 30 minutes
  • Strawberry Dumplings (9)Total Time: 45 minutes
  • Strawberry Dumplings (10)Yield: 8 dumplings 1x
  • Strawberry Dumplings (11)Category: Dessert
  • Strawberry Dumplings (12)Method: Oven
  • Strawberry Dumplings (13)Cuisine: English

Print Recipe

Description

These Strawberry Dumplings served with a scoop of vanilla ice cream are perfect for spring and summer. Crescent rolls filled with strawberries and baked in butter & brown sugar sauce. They’re the perfect balance between soft and crispy!

Ingredients

  • 1 (8 ounce) can crescent rolls
  • 1 sticks butter
  • 3/4 cups brown sugar
  • 1 teaspoons vanilla
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 1 teaspoon lemon juice
  • 1/2 cup lemon soda
  • 2/3 cup fresh srawberries-diced

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ven at 350 F ; butter 8×8 inch baking dish and set aside.
  2. Roll diced strawberries in a crescent roll and place in a buttered dish.
  3. Melt butter, stir in brown sugar, cinnamon, lemon juice and vanilla, remove from heat and pour over the dumplings.
  4. Pour the soda in the middle and along the edges of a pan (not over the rolls)
  5. Bake for 30-35 minutes, or until they become golden brown.
  6. Serve warm.
